Looking for a casual place with lunch specials in Miami Lakes. Cute, basic, clean Columbian fast food stop. Tables & take out counter with waitress service. Small menu with daily specials in the $10-13 range. I ordered a nice platter with pork cutlet, soup, fried bananas & rice for $10. Good, friendly service from the bilingual server. SUPER! I went here looking for a McDonalds alternative and found a Columbian restaurant in the shopping center. Chivas seems to be more for local clients and has a smaller setting inside. The restaurant serves churrasco. I ordered the frijoles rojo and the maduros with 2 diet coke. The menu is attached and the prices are very good. The service was quick and the waitresses were friendly. I do recommend

Everything was absolutely delicious. We had beef and chicharron empanadas with cafe con leche. They told me about the empanadas deal which was 12 for 17 dollars or something like that but we declined because we thought 12 would be too much but we were left wanting more! I should have definitely taken that deal. I don’t live in Miami anymore but when I return to the area, I will for sure come back. Muchísimas gracias!!
